**Finance Review Summary — FY Headcount Plan**

Next year's plan holds total headcount broadly flat. Orchard Systems division adds four engineering roles; Client Services at Denholm House reduces by two through attrition. Salary inflation is budgeted at 4%, and contractor spend is capped at current levels. Department heads should submit revised org charts by month-end. The underlying planning assumptions are recorded in the note below.

board note of bawep-tajef: Queniusek Systems plans to raise the Quenvan list price by 53.1 percent in March. The pricing group signed off on a budget of $176.4 million for Project Drueth. The renewal with Casionix Partners closes at $142.5 million a year, 8.3 percent below the last contract. Project Fraax slips by six weeks because of the tooling delay.

The client submits resize
 * jobs to the render farm and polls for completion; jobs are idempotent, so
 * retries are safe. As a new contractor, note that output dimensions are
 * validated server-side — the CLI only performs basic sanity checks. Keep
 * concurrency at or below four workers until you've read the throttling
 * notes in docs/limits. The client authenticates with the internal service
 * key provided below.
 */

gateway credential: kto3_qfe

Fan-out backpressure for the Quillet notifier: when the queue depth crosses the soft limit, the dispatcher sheds low-priority pushes and batches the rest at 500ms intervals. Reviewer should confirm the shed counter is exported and that retries respect the jitter window. Once merged, the release artifact gets re-signed by the pipeline, which expects the deploy key shown below.

deploy key for bawep-yawif: bky6_GQhaSt